The Science Behind Our Sanitization & Disinfection Process

Our team follows a meticulous process to ensure your home is thoroughly sanitized and disinfected. We start by assessing the damage and identifying areas that need attention. Next, we use specialized equipment to remove any standing water, dry the affected areas, and remove any remaining moisture. This is followed by a thorough sanitization and disinfection process, which includes the use of antimicrobial treatments and ozone generators to remove bacteria, viruses, and fungi.

Step 1: Damage Assessment and Water Removal

We’ll assess the damage and remove any standing water using specialized equipment, such as wet vacuums and extractors. This step is crucial in preventing further damage and creating a safe environment for our technicians to work in.

Step 2: Drying and Moisture Elimination

We’ll use industrial-grade dehumidifiers and air movers to dry the affected areas, ensuring that all moisture is eliminated and the environment is safe for sanitization and disinfection.

Step 3: Sanitization and Disinfection

We’ll apply antimicrobial treatments and ozone generators to remove bacteria, viruses, and fungi, creating a safe and healthy environment for you and your family.

Step 4: Final Inspection and Clean-up

We’ll conduct a final inspection to ensure that all affected areas have been thoroughly sanitized and disinfected. We’ll also clean up any debris or materials removed during the process.

Warning Signs You Need Sanitization & Disinfection Services

Catching these signs early can save you money and prevent bigger problems down the line. Here are some common warning signs that show you need our Sanitization & Disinfection Services: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ors can be a sign of mold growth or water damage. If you notice musty smells in your home, it’s essential to address the issue quickly to prevent further damage.

Water Stains or Warping on Walls or Floors

Water stains or warping on walls or floors can show water damage or leaks. Ignoring these issues can lead to costly repairs and health risks.

Unexplained Allergies or Respiratory Issues

Unexplained allergies or respiratory issues can be a sign of mold or bacteria growth in your home. Our Sanitization & Disinfection Services can help remove these health risks and create a safe environment.

Peeling Paint or Warping Wood

Peeling paint or warping wood can show water damage or high humidity levels. Our team can assess the damage and provide the necessary repairs to prevent further issues.

Black Mold or Fungus Growth

Black mold or fungus growth can be a sign of severe water damage or poor ventilation. Our Sanitization & Disinfection Services can help remove these health risks and prevent further damage.

Unpleasant Smells in Your HVAC System

Unpleasant smells in your HVAC system can show mold or bacteria growth. Our team can inspect and clean your system to ensure it’s working efficiently and safely.

Sanitization & Disinfection Services Cost in Kline, SC

The cost of Sanitization & Disinfection Services can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Kline, SC. Here are some estimated price ranges for our services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Damage Assessment and Repair $500 – $2,500 The cost of this service depends on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area.
Sanitization and Disinfection $1,000 – $5,000 The cost of this service depends on the size of the affected area and the type of equipment used.
Moisture Elimination and Drying $500 – $2,000 The cost of this service depends on the size of the affected area and the type of equipment used.
Antimicrobial Treatment $500 – $2,000 The cost of this service depends on the size of the affected area and the type of equipment used.
Ozone Generator Rental $200 – $1,000 The cost of this service depends on the size of the affected area and the rental duration.
Final Inspection and Clean-up $500 – $2,000 The cost of this service depends on the size of the affected area and the type of equipment used.
